New Spectrum Internet customers typically encounter a one-time standard installation fee of $59.99 when scheduling professional installation. Opting for self-installation reduces this upfront cost to $24.99, which covers the shipment of a self-install kit. For in-home WiFi activation, there is a monthly charge of $5.00, but this is separate from the upfront installation expenses.
Certain April 2026 promotions extend fee waivers for new customers. Selected plans offer free standard installation, removing the usual $59.99 fee. Some Internet-only offers also include complimentary self-installation kits, eliminating the $24.99 charge entirely. These promotions apply exclusively to eligible new sign-ups between April 1 and April 30, 2026.

Spectrum stands out among major internet providers by offering all standard residential internet plans without long-term contracts. Subscribers have the flexibility to end their service at any time without incurring early termination fees. According to Charter Communications, 100% of Spectrum Internet plans are contract-free as of April 2026; this policy applies regardless of the package or promotional deal selected (Spectrum Terms of Service).

Switching internet services requires a clear plan. Begin by scheduling your Spectrum installation for a day before or on the same day your previous provider's service ends. This overlap will avoid internet downtime. Gather your existing contracts, as knowing the exact dates minimizes gaps or unexpected charges.
Notify your old provider the moment your Spectrum connection is set up and tested. This action guarantees the seamless transfer of services. Sometimes, Spectrum offers to buy out contracts from competitors up to a certain dollar amount—always ask about this potential saving during your sign-up call.
